4. Ordinal Numbers: These are used to indicate order or position, like "first," "second," and "third." They are different from cardinal numbers, which indicate quantity, like "one," "two," and "three.

5. Fractional Numbers: These are used to express parts of a whole, such as "one-third" or "half.

6. Large Numbers: English has specific terms for large numbers, such as "thousand," "million," "billion," and "trillion," which are used to avoid long strings of digits.
